Museum Day: The Holmes Museum of Anthropology

Event Date:Saturday, September 26, 2009
Event Time:10:00 AM - 3:00 PM

Museum Day is a special event presented in conjunction with Smithsonian Magazine that provides free passes to thousands of museums across the United States. The Lowell D. Holmes Museum of Anthropology, located at 108 Neff Hall, will be open on Saturday the 26th from 10 AM to 3 PM. Free passes (while they last) to several other local museums are available on the web at www.smithsonianmag.com/museumday.

Other participating museums that will honor the Museum Day free passes on Saturday the 26th of September include: Botanica, Exploration Place, Kansas Firefighters Museum, Kansas Sports Hall of Fame, Lake Afton Public Observatory, Mid-American All-Indian Center, Old Cowtown Museum, Wichita Art Museum, Wichita Center for the Arts and the Wichita-Sedgwick County Historical Museum.
